[發明專利]在線視頻的內容發布呈現系統及發布呈現方法有效
| 申請號: | 201310711949.8 | 申請日: | 2013-12-18 |
| 公開(公告)號: | CN103702221B | 公開(公告)日: | 2017-08-08 |
| 發明(設計)人: | 黃大勇 | 申請(專利權)人: | TCL集團股份有限公司 |
| 主分類號: | H04N21/472 | 分類號: | H04N21/472;H04N21/8543;H04N21/83;G06F17/30 |
| 代理公司: | 深圳市君勝知識產權代理事務所(普通合伙)44268 | 代理人: | 王永文,劉文求 |
| 地址: | 516001 廣東省惠州市*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 在線視頻 內容 發布 呈現 系統 方法 | ||
技術領域
本發明涉及在線視頻技術領域,特別涉及一種在線視頻的內容發布呈現系統及發布呈現方法。
背景技術
在線視頻進入電視屏幕是互聯網電視的標志之一。提供海量、高清的在線視頻是現有電視行業滿足用戶需求、獲得收益的重要手段。目前,視頻內容提供商和智能電視廠商是相互獨立的,也即是說,同時擁有視頻內容和智能電視硬件平臺的公司基本沒有,因此視頻內容提供商和智能電視廠商需要合作,強強聯合來發揮各自的優勢。
目前的合作方式主要是由視頻內容提供商提供API(應用程序接口),智能電視廠商利用API開發出相應的客戶端。對于智能電視廠商來講,這種方式對于在線視頻的呈現存在以下問題:
1、客戶端重復開發。由于一個API對應開發出一個客戶端,則每與一個視頻內容提供商合作就要開發一個新的客戶端。一個智能電視廠商同時與多個視頻內容提供商合作的情況非常普遍,所以就要開發出多個客戶端。其實所有客戶端的功能是相似的,有些功能可以復用,完全獨立地重新開發客戶端大大浪費了資源和開發時間。
2、客戶端不能適應變化。當視頻內容提供商增、刪或修改API時客戶端必須升級,否則會導致新功能不能使用,甚至連原有功能都不能使用。雖然智能電視廠商一般都有自己的應用商店,可以從應用商店升級客戶端,但是,每次升級都需要到相應的應用商店,會花費用戶的時間和交通成本,升級比較麻煩。
3、客戶端方式的在線視頻的核心技術由視頻內容提供商掌握,視頻內容提供商處于支配地位,智能電視廠商處于相對被動的地位;不利于市場公平、合理交易的實現。
另外,在線視頻還可以采用瀏覽器方式實現。視頻內容提供商都有自己的web網站,在瀏覽器中打開就可以直接觀看。但是這種方式也存在一些問題,例如,智能電視中瀏覽器的播放兼容性一般都很差,在瀏覽器中使用電視遙控器操作在線視頻的瀏覽和播放十分不方便。
發明內容
鑒于上述現有技術的不足之處,本發明的目的在于提供一種在線視頻的內容發布呈現系統及發布呈現方法,以解決現有客戶端需重復開發、不能適應API變化的問題。
為了達到上述目的,本發明采取了以下技術方案:
一種在線視頻的內容發布呈現系統,其包括:
內容提供源服務端,用于提供REST API和在線視頻的視頻內容;
內容發布服務端,用于根據所述REST API,以及內容呈現終端預存的XML網頁格式和Javascript功能接口生成相應的XML網頁;
內容呈現終端,用于預存XML網頁格式和Javascript功能接口,從內容發布服務端下載XML網頁,對所述XML網頁進行解析并執行相應的Javascript腳本,實現在線視頻的瀏覽和播放;
所述內容發布服務端、內容呈現終端、內容提供源服務端依次連接。
所述的在線視頻的內容發布呈現系統,其中,所述XML網頁格式包括用于設置界面的布局、風格、資源來源的XML標簽,以及實現本地調用功能的Javascript腳本接口。
所述的在線視頻的內容發布呈現系統,其中,所述XML網頁包括:
全局初始化單元,用于對頁面所需全局數據進行初始化;
全局描述單元,用于對頁面包含的信息進行描述;
頁面呈現描述單元,用于對頁面的整體布局風格進行描述;
單影片呈現描述單元,用于對單個影片的頁面的布局風格進行描述;
Javascript腳本。
所述的在線視頻的內容發布呈現系統,其中,所述內容呈現終端包括:
核心引擎模塊,用于對XML網頁進行解析、呈現流程并監控網頁數和網頁堆的狀態;
基礎功能模塊,用于實現XML解析,執行javascript腳本,監控文件和目錄以及監控下載的資源;
插件模塊,用于提供不同平臺的接口來執行相應的功能;
系統移植層,用于對不同平臺的API進行封裝適配。
所述的在線視頻的內容發布呈現系統,其中,所述核心引擎模塊包括:
引擎初始化單元,用于對整個內容發布呈現系統進行初始化;
網頁渲染器,用于從內容發布服務端下載XML網頁,并對XML網頁進行分析、渲染,以及監控單個XML網頁的頁面上下文;
網頁事件循環單元,用于對XML網頁中的事件進行偵聽和處理;
網頁堆管理單元,用于對網頁鏈條進行緩存控制。
所述的在線視頻的內容發布呈現系統,其中,所述基礎功能模塊包括: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于TCL集團股份有限公司,未經TCL集團股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310711949.8/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種簡易多功能覆膜機
- 下一篇:一種帶USB接口的多功能機頂盒
- 內容再現系統、內容提供方法、內容再現裝置、內容提供裝置、內容再現程序和內容提供程序
- 內容記錄系統、內容記錄方法、內容記錄設備和內容接收設備
- 內容服務系統、內容服務器、內容終端及內容服務方法
- 內容分發系統、內容分發裝置、內容再生終端及內容分發方法
- 內容發布、內容獲取的方法、內容發布裝置及內容傳播系統
- 內容提供裝置、內容提供方法、內容再現裝置、內容再現方法
- 內容傳輸設備、內容傳輸方法、內容再現設備、內容再現方法、程序及內容分發系統
- 內容發送設備、內容發送方法、內容再現設備、內容再現方法、程序及內容分發系統
- 內容再現裝置、內容再現方法、內容再現程序及內容提供系統
- 內容記錄裝置、內容編輯裝置、內容再生裝置、內容記錄方法、內容編輯方法、以及內容再生方法





